Creation of microdomains in an atomic force microscope in strontium-barium niobate ferroelectric crystals

Abstract: Microdomains in SBN-0.61 polydomain crystals have been recorded by the atomic force microscopy method with the application of a dc voltage of 1–10 V applied to a probe. The domain areas have been obtained as functions of the voltage and exposition time. The kinetics of the decay of the domains after the shutdown of the field have been determined. The nonclassical characteristics observed in the dynamics of domain walls are attributed to the nonuniform spatial distribution of the atomic force microscope field. The kinetics of the decay of the microdomains are in qualitative agreement with the kinetics of the depolarization of the strontium-barium niobate solutions, which is observed by macroscopic methods.
